Output 51be20b33d2c21385fbf384c6f316b9122419892596e35507f92bd558ccf124c:1

value
26056900
script pubkey
OP_0 OP_PUSHBYTES_20 067da084b15feaa9aef77c499e1647ef6d4a87a4
address
ltc1qqe76pp93tl42nthh03yeu9j8aak54pay88c0h3
transaction
51be20b33d2c21385fbf384c6f316b9122419892596e35507f92bd558ccf124c
spent
true